Frequently asked questions

Which early-opening cafes are in Hobart?+

Hobart Coffee Roasters, Ginger Brown, Imago Cafe & Bakery, Dandy Lane Cafe, and SOMEWHERE COFFEE BAR all open early in Hobart.

Where should I go for early coffee in Launceston?+

Tatler Lane by Sweetbrew, LOCAL HIDEOUT CAFE, Boathouse Coffee, The Flying Sparrow Cafe, and Bread + Butter | Cafe all serve early in Launceston.

Are there early-opening cafes outside the major cities?+

Yes. The Chapel in Burnie and Laneway in Devonport both open early, giving you options if you're in the north-west or north-central regions.

Do any of these cafes focus specifically on coffee?+

Hobart Coffee Roasters roasts its own beans, Boathouse Coffee specialises in coffee, and SOMEWHERE COFFEE BAR is a dedicated coffee bar.

Should I call ahead to confirm opening hours?+

We've listed these as early-opening cafes, but specific hours aren't guaranteed across all venues. It's always wise to call or check their social media before heading in, especially on public holidays.
